Roy bought Mescal. Legal here. Made from agave
pineapple. They cut off the root. Cut off the long sharp limbs. Then put them on coals covered
up and steam them. Not sure where they go from there but it is a legitimate job here and Mescal
is sold everywhere. The cost ranges from very cheap to WOW expensive.
Now the tree----is incredible!! It is huge. It is world known, the biggest tree in the world. Not as tall as the Redwoods or Sequoias , but massive.
There is a postcard they sell and it has 5 men, holding hands and arms stretched out and it does
not even begin to go 1/4 a way around the base of the tree.
This is an information picture you can get an idea about the tree. It is over 2000 years old. They
took a core sample and it is all one tree. Some thought it was a group of trees that had grown
together to form one------but no , it is just one tree.
